Minho Blend Branco 2019Azal, Arinto - Three Bottles
a loamy soil at an altitude of 400 meters, an uncompromising wine that combines a classic vinification with indigenous yeasts and a year's stay in stainless steel at a controlled temperature with the absence of added sulfites, replaced by the use of a natural product made from chestnut flowers. From a plant adjacent to the estate vineyards, the flowers are harvested in July before being dried and turned into powder: the addition tested is 40 grams per hectolitre and the result surprised everyone. The Instituto Politécnico de Bragança has been precisely studying the antioxidant and antimicrobial effects since 2015. Wine for fish, seafood and white meat.
Vinho Verde Loureiro 2019, Loureiro - Three Bottles
Made only from Loureiro grapes (along with Alvarinho, the most important white grape variety in the area), vinified with indigenous yeasts and left to mature for just under a year in stainless steel tanks at a controlled temperature before a period of about 6 months in the bottle. Mineral, aromatic and fruity, it stands out for its perturbing drinkability and strong character in which the acidity is vehement but never the protagonist. It has little alcohol but is very significant, inviting you to return to the glass again and again. Truly a little gem.

LIXA (Portugal)
Fernando Paiva, former professor of history, was one of the pioneers of Portuguese biodynamics. Over the years, he became interested in the Steiner principles, which he adopted in 2007.
Quinta da Palmirinha is one of the few Demeter-certified wineries in all of Portugal and is located in the vicinity of the village of Lixa , in northwest Portugal.
